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Посчитать в тексте количество удвоенных букв n -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Перегруженная функция sqrt http://www.cyberforum.ru/cpp-beginners/thread354581.html
# include<iostream> #include<cmath> using namespace std; #define PI 3.14159265 int main(){ double z1,z2,a; cout <<"enter a "<<endl; cin>>a; z1=cos(a)+sin(a)+cos(3*a)+sin(3*a); ...
C++ задачка c++ дан текстоавй файл включающий строки, содержащие цифры 1,3,4 5 8,2,3,5,8 2,7 написать програму, которая сделает выходной файл: 34 15 58 27 http://www.cyberforum.ru/cpp-beginners/thread354579.html
Как передать функцию в Thread()? C++
Привет, всем. У меня есть простенькая программка состоящая из пару функций. Теперь я хочу передать эти функции в Тhread(), но не знаю, как это сделать, подскажите пожалуйста, как это осуществить,...
C++ Создание пользовательского интерфейса
Приветы форумчанам. Вообщем встал вопрос создание графического интерфейса пользователя(GUI если не ошибаюсь) Использую VS2008 До этого писал только консольные программы(С++), ни с какими...
C++ Вычислить значение функции на интервале с определенным шагом http://www.cyberforum.ru/cpp-beginners/thread354575.html
Здравствуйте! Помогите пожалуйста разобраться в последней части условия, если возможно, помочь кодом. Задачу прикрепил в сообщение. Вот мои наработки: #include <iostream> #include <math.h>...
C++ разработка объекта синхронизации нужно создать объект синхронизации с разделяемыми уровнями блокировки: для чтения и для записи. Одновременно блокировка на чтение возможна из нескольких тредов, а на запись - только из одного, при... подробнее

Показать сообщение отдельно
xAtom
915 / 740 / 60
Регистрация: 09.12.2010
Сообщений: 1,346
Записей в блоге: 1
21.09.2011, 18:14
Цитата Сообщение от Serjant0007 Посмотреть сообщение
P.S. старый компилятор Borland C++ 3.1
Ну если старый то вот.
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
#include <stdio.h>
#include <string.h>
 
int ch_double(const char* str, char ch) {
  int len;
  for(len = 0;*str; *str++) {
      if( *str == ch ) {
          if(*(str + 1) == ch) {
                len++;
                *str++;
           }
      }
  }
  return len;
}
 
int  main(void) {
   char buf[32];
 
   printf("enter string: ");
   gets(buf);
   printf("count: %d\n", ch_double(buf, 'n'));
 
   getchar();
   return 0;
}
0
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ru